On February 15, 2019, the song "Mangithanda Ngingagxuma" was released by Solly Moholo. With this song being about 5 minutes long, at This song is fairly a long song compared to the average song length. This song does not have an "Explicit" tag, making it safe for all ages. There are a total of 14 in the song's album "Tsoha Jonase Nice Time Ya Bolaya". In this album, this song's track order is #5. Furthermore, we believe that the track originated from South Africa. The popularity of Mangithanda Ngingagxuma is currently not that popular right now. The overall tone is very danceable, especially with its high energy, which produces more of a euphoric, cheerful, or happy vibe.
With Mangithanda Ngingagxuma by Solly Moholo having a BPM of 172 with a half-time of 86 BPM and a double-time of 344 BPM, we would consider this track to have a Vivace (lively and fast) tempo marking. Because of this, we believe that the song has an overall fast tempo.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
This song has a musical key of A♭ Major.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 4B. So, the perfect camelot match for 4B would be either 4B or 5A.
